Searched refs:mempool_t (Results 1 – 25 of 84) sorted by relevance
1234
/Linux-v4.19/include/linux/ |
D | mempool.h | 26 } mempool_t; typedef 28 static inline bool mempool_initialized(mempool_t *pool) in mempool_initialized() 33 void mempool_exit(mempool_t *pool); 34 int mempool_init_node(mempool_t *pool, int min_nr, mempool_alloc_t *alloc_fn, 37 int mempool_init(mempool_t *pool, int min_nr, mempool_alloc_t *alloc_fn, 40 extern mempool_t *mempool_create(int min_nr, mempool_alloc_t *alloc_fn, 42 extern mempool_t *mempool_create_node(int min_nr, mempool_alloc_t *alloc_fn, 46 extern int mempool_resize(mempool_t *pool, int new_min_nr); 47 extern void mempool_destroy(mempool_t *pool); 48 extern void *mempool_alloc(mempool_t *pool, gfp_t gfp_mask) __malloc; [all …]
|
D | btree.h | 37 mempool_t *mempool; 67 void btree_init_mempool(struct btree_head *head, mempool_t *mempool);
|
D | bio.h | 424 extern int biovec_init_pool(mempool_t *pool, int pool_entries); 527 extern struct bio_vec *bvec_alloc(gfp_t, int, unsigned long *, mempool_t *); 528 extern void bvec_free(mempool_t *, struct bio_vec *, unsigned int); 749 mempool_t bio_pool; 750 mempool_t bvec_pool; 752 mempool_t bio_integrity_pool; 753 mempool_t bvec_integrity_pool;
|
D | pktcdvd.h | 189 mempool_t rb_pool; /* mempool for pkt_rb_node allocations */
|
D | btree-128.h | 7 mempool_t *mempool) in btree_init_mempool128()
|
D | btree-type.h | 15 mempool_t *mempool) in BTREE_FN()
|
/Linux-v4.19/mm/ |
D | mempool.c | 25 static void poison_error(mempool_t *pool, void *element, size_t size, in poison_error() 42 static void __check_element(mempool_t *pool, void *element, size_t size) in __check_element() 58 static void check_element(mempool_t *pool, void *element) in check_element() 82 static void poison_element(mempool_t *pool, void *element) in poison_element() 98 static inline void check_element(mempool_t *pool, void *element) in check_element() 101 static inline void poison_element(mempool_t *pool, void *element) in poison_element() 106 static __always_inline void kasan_poison_element(mempool_t *pool, void *element) in kasan_poison_element() 114 static void kasan_unpoison_element(mempool_t *pool, void *element) in kasan_unpoison_element() 122 static __always_inline void add_element(mempool_t *pool, void *element) in add_element() 130 static void *remove_element(mempool_t *pool) in remove_element() [all …]
|
/Linux-v4.19/drivers/s390/scsi/ |
D | zfcp_def.h | 104 mempool_t *erp_req; 105 mempool_t *gid_pn_req; 106 mempool_t *scsi_req; 107 mempool_t *scsi_abort; 108 mempool_t *status_read_req; 109 mempool_t *sr_data; 110 mempool_t *gid_pn; 111 mempool_t *qtcb_pool; 313 mempool_t *pool;
|
D | zfcp_ext.h | 125 mempool_t *, unsigned int);
|
/Linux-v4.19/drivers/md/ |
D | dm-verity-fec.h | 49 mempool_t rs_pool; /* mempool for fio->rs */ 50 mempool_t prealloc_pool; /* mempool for preallocated buffers */ 51 mempool_t extra_pool; /* mempool for extra buffers */ 52 mempool_t output_pool; /* mempool for output */
|
D | raid1.h | 121 mempool_t r1bio_pool; 122 mempool_t r1buf_pool;
|
D | raid10.h | 96 mempool_t r10bio_pool; 97 mempool_t r10buf_pool;
|
D | md-multipath.h | 16 mempool_t pool;
|
/Linux-v4.19/block/ |
D | bounce.c | 32 static mempool_t page_pool, isa_page_pool; 143 static void bounce_end_io(struct bio *bio, mempool_t *pool) in bounce_end_io() 178 static void __bounce_end_io_read(struct bio *bio, mempool_t *pool) in __bounce_end_io_read() 266 mempool_t *pool) in __blk_queue_bounce() 336 mempool_t *pool; in blk_queue_bounce()
|
/Linux-v4.19/include/linux/ceph/ |
D | msgpool.h | 13 mempool_t *pool;
|
/Linux-v4.19/fs/cifs/ |
D | smbdirect.h | 180 mempool_t *request_mempool; 184 mempool_t *response_mempool;
|
D | cifsfs.c | 96 extern mempool_t *cifs_sm_req_poolp; 97 extern mempool_t *cifs_req_poolp; 98 extern mempool_t *cifs_mid_poolp; 269 mempool_t *cifs_sm_req_poolp; 270 mempool_t *cifs_req_poolp; 271 mempool_t *cifs_mid_poolp;
|
/Linux-v4.19/drivers/scsi/lpfc/ |
D | lpfc.h | 956 mempool_t *mbox_mem_pool; 957 mempool_t *nlp_mem_pool; 958 mempool_t *rrq_pool; 959 mempool_t *active_rrq_pool; 1103 mempool_t *device_data_mem_pool;
|
/Linux-v4.19/drivers/scsi/fnic/ |
D | fnic.h | 276 mempool_t *io_req_pool; 277 mempool_t *io_sgl_pool[FNIC_SGL_NUM_CACHES];
|
/Linux-v4.19/drivers/lightnvm/ |
D | pblk.h | 690 mempool_t page_bio_pool; 691 mempool_t gen_ws_pool; 692 mempool_t rec_pool; 693 mempool_t r_rq_pool; 694 mempool_t w_rq_pool; 695 mempool_t e_rq_pool;
|
/Linux-v4.19/drivers/md/bcache/ |
D | bcache.h | 532 mempool_t search; 533 mempool_t bio_meta; 663 mempool_t fill_iter;
|
/Linux-v4.19/lib/ |
D | sg_pool.c | 13 mempool_t *pool;
|
/Linux-v4.19/drivers/block/aoe/ |
D | aoe.h | 172 mempool_t *bufpool; /* for deadlock-free Buf allocation */
|
/Linux-v4.19/drivers/scsi/csiostor/ |
D | csio_hw.h | 527 mempool_t *mb_mempool; /* Mailbox memory pool*/ 528 mempool_t *rnode_mempool; /* rnode memory pool */
|
/Linux-v4.19/fs/gfs2/ |
D | util.c | 31 mempool_t *gfs2_page_pool __read_mostly;
|
1234